## Runbook: Matchline GC pause mitigation

If Matchline p99 spikes during rollout, suspect GC pauses in the pairing workers. Roll out the tuned heap flags via the canary channel first; hold 20 minutes, then proceed. The canary config push must be signed or the fleet ignores it. Release manager signs with the rotation key current as of this cycle, given below.

rollout seal: bky4_yke3

Key Ceremony Checklist — Item 7 (Shadeproof Audit Vault)

Support team: before the contrast-audit results for the Glimmerhall portal are sealed, confirm both custodians are present and the witness log is signed. Unlock the Shadeproof archive during the ceremony window only, entering the ceremony passphrase exactly as it appears below.

unlock words, yadup-yagef: zorael-druix

## Environments — Fernwheel Rules Engine

Welcome aboard! Fernwheel computes shipping fees from a rule set that merchandising edits in a web console. We run three environments: dev (anything goes), staging (mirrors prod rules nightly), and prod (change-controlled, don't touch without a ticket). Rules are versioned, so a bad publish can be rolled back in seconds — staging first, always. Note that dev uses synthetic carrier rates, so fee totals there won't match prod. Each environment's settings are captured below for reference.

deployment values, bahof-badug:
[rusix]
team = zorok
access_code = ac_641cbe
owner = ulair.tamius
host = rusix.torvasoft.local
port = 5672
peer = ulaix.sivrelworks.internal
salt = 1df570ed
pin = 6327